Yogoberry is a Brazilian chain of frozen yogurt stores, known for its wide variety of flavors and toppings. Founded in 2007, Yogoberry quickly became a popular destination for those seeking a healthier alternative to traditional ice cream. The brand emphasizes the use of natural ingredients and offers a self-service model that allows customers to customize their frozen yogurt experience.

History[edit | edit source]

Yogoberry was established in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, by entrepreneurs who saw an opportunity to introduce a healthier dessert option to the Brazilian market. The concept was inspired by the growing trend of frozen yogurt in the United States and adapted to suit local tastes. The first store opened in the upscale neighborhood of Ipanema, and its success led to rapid expansion across the country.

Products[edit | edit source]

Yogoberry offers a diverse range of frozen yogurt flavors, including classic options like vanilla and chocolate, as well as unique flavors such as açai and passion fruit, which cater to local preferences. The brand is known for its commitment to using natural ingredients, with no artificial flavors or preservatives.

Customers can choose from a variety of toppings, including fresh fruits, nuts, and candies, allowing for a personalized dessert experience. The self-service model enables customers to control portion sizes and mix different flavors and toppings according to their preferences.

Business Model[edit | edit source]

Yogoberry operates on a franchise model, which has facilitated its rapid growth throughout Brazil. The brand's success is attributed to its innovative approach to the frozen dessert market, focusing on health-conscious consumers and offering a customizable product.

The stores are designed to provide a modern and inviting atmosphere, with a focus on cleanliness and customer service. Yogoberry's marketing strategy includes partnerships with local events and sponsorships, which have helped to increase brand visibility and attract a loyal customer base.

Market Presence[edit | edit source]

Since its inception, Yogoberry has expanded beyond Brazil, with stores in several other countries in South America. The brand's international presence is a testament to its popularity and the universal appeal of its product offering.
